To make the most of your trip, plan your visit between late spring and early fall (May to October). This period offers the most pleasant weather for outdoor activities, and all attractions are fully operational. However, be sure to book your accommodations well in advance, especially for peak summer months, as these incredible resorts fill up quickly!

The Lodge at Deadwood

The Lodge at Deadwood offers an exhilarating blend of Wild West history and modern entertainment, making it a standout destination in the historic town of Deadwood. What truly sets this resort apart is its vibrant atmosphere, featuring a lively casino, an indoor water park perfect for families, and a variety of dining options. You can spend your mornings exploring the town’s legendary past, walking the same streets as Wild Bill Hickok and Calamity Jane, then return to the lodge for a splash-filled afternoon at the water park, or try your luck at the gaming tables.
The resortβs proximity to Deadwood’s historic Main Street means you’re just steps away from unique shops, saloons, and museums. It’s an ideal spot for families seeking entertainment, couples looking for a mix of relaxation and excitement, and solo travelers interested in the local history and gaming scene. The lodge often hosts live entertainment and events, adding to its dynamic appeal.

The Mount Rushmore Resort at Palmer Gulch

Nestled amidst the pine-covered hills just minutes from the iconic Mount Rushmore, The Mount Rushmore Resort at Palmer Gulch is an expansive retreat offering an unparalleled family vacation experience. What makes it unique is its incredible array of on-site activities and diverse accommodation options, ranging from tent sites and RV spots to cozy cabins and luxury lodges. Youβll find a massive water park, a chuckwagon supper show, mini-golf, horseback riding, and even a fishing pond.
Itβs designed to be a self-contained adventure hub where boredom is simply not an option. Visitors can expect days filled with laughter and exploration, with the majestic backdrop of the Black Hills. This resort is absolutely perfect for families with children of all ages, offering something for everyone from toddlers to teens, and even grandparents. Its close proximity to Mount Rushmore and Custer State Park makes it an excellent base for exploring the region’s top attractions.

Spearfish Canyon Lodge

Spearfish Canyon Lodge, nestled deep within the breathtaking Spearfish Canyon, is a true gem that offers an immersive experience in one of South Dakota’s most scenic natural wonders. Its unique appeal lies in its rustic yet elegant design, blending seamlessly with the dramatic canyon walls, towering pines, and the rushing waters of Spearfish Creek. What you can expect here is direct access to stunning waterfalls like Roughlock Falls and Bridal Veil Falls, along with countless hiking and biking trails.
The lodge itself provides a cozy, inviting atmosphere with a grand fireplace and comfortable rooms. This destination is perfect for outdoor adventurers, nature photographers, couples seeking a romantic and picturesque escape, and anyone who appreciates the raw beauty of the Black Hills. The fall foliage in Spearfish Canyon is particularly spectacular, making it a highly sought-after destination during that season.

Sylvan Lake Lodge

Sylvan Lake Lodge, an iconic stone and timber masterpiece, stands majestically overlooking the famous Sylvan Lake within Custer State Park. What makes this lodge truly unique is its unparalleled setting amidst towering granite Needles and the crystal-clear waters of the lake, offering some of the most breathtaking views in the entire state. The lodge itself exudes historic charm and comfort, providing a serene escape.
Visitors can expect direct access to the lake for swimming, kayaking, and paddleboarding, as well as numerous hiking trails, including the popular trail to Harney Peak (Black Elk Peak). It’s an ideal choice for nature lovers, avid hikers, photographers, and families looking for an unforgettable experience in the heart of the Black Hills. The sunsets over Sylvan Lake are legendary, creating a magical atmosphere each evening.

The State Game Lodge

The State Game Lodge, a grand historic lodge nestled within Custer State Park, holds a special place in American history as the “Summer White House” for Presidents Calvin Coolidge and Dwight D. Eisenhower. What makes this lodge truly exceptional is its rich historical significance combined with its prime location for wildlife viewing.
You can expect elegant accommodations, often with original period furnishings, and the chance to spot bison, elk, and deer right from the lodge grounds. It’s an ideal base for exploring the Wildlife Loop Road, where youβre almost guaranteed to encounter the park’s famous bison herd. This lodge is perfect for history buffs, wildlife enthusiasts, and families seeking a blend of comfort and adventure. The lodge also offers unique experiences like open-air jeep tours into the bison herd, providing an up-close and personal encounter with nature.

Blue Bell Lodge

Blue Bell Lodge, another charming retreat within Custer State Park, offers a more rustic and authentic Western experience. What truly sets Blue Bell apart is its focus on equestrian activities and its renowned Chuckwagon Cookout, providing a taste of the Old West. The accommodations are cozy cabins and lodge rooms, exuding a warm, inviting atmosphere.
You can expect days filled with horseback riding through scenic trails, enjoying hearty Western meals, and relaxing in a laid-back, friendly environment. It’s an excellent choice for families with children who love horses, couples seeking a unique Western adventure, and anyone looking for a relaxed, authentic Black Hills experience. The Chuckwagon Cookout, complete with hayrides and cowboy entertainment, is a highlight that creates lasting memories for visitors of all ages.
